Understanding the Phishing Threat Landscape

Phishing attacks, deceptive attempts to trick individuals into divulging sensitive information or performing actions that compromise security, remain a prevalent threat in the cybersecurity ecosystem. These attacks often involve deceptive emails, fraudulent websites, and social engineering tactics. Sophos addresses this multifaceted threat landscape with a comprehensive and adaptive approach.

1. Sophos Email Security: Shielding Against Phishing Emails

Overview:

Sophos leverages advanced email security solutions to fortify users against phishing emails, recognising them as a primary vector for cyber threats. This involves a combination of real-time threat detection, behavioural analysis, and threat intelligence.

Key Features of Sophos Email Security:

  • Real-Time Threat Detection: Sophos employs advanced threat detection technologies to identify and neutralise phishing emails in real-time, preventing them from reaching the user’s inbox.
  • Behavioural Analysis: By scrutinising the behaviour of emails and their components, Sophos can identify patterns indicative of phishing attempts, even when traditional signature-based methods may fall short.
  • Link and Attachment Scanning: Sophos scans links and attachments within emails, ensuring that users are protected from malicious content that may be used in phishing attacks.

2. Web Filtering: Safeguarding Against Phishing Websites

Overview:

Phishing attacks often involve deceptive websites designed to mimic legitimate platforms. Sophos incorporates robust web filtering mechanisms to proactively block access to phishing websites, thus safeguarding users during their online activities.

Key Features of Sophos Web Filtering:

  • Phishing Website Blocking: Sophos maintains an extensive database of known phishing websites and utilises real-time analysis to identify and block access to these deceptive platforms.
  • Category-Based Blocking: Web filtering involves categorising websites based on content, enabling Sophos to block access to categories associated with phishing and fraudulent activities.

3. Sophos Intercept X: A Specialised Defence Against Phishing Threats

Overview:

Intercept X, Sophos‘ advanced endpoint protection solution, stands as a specialised arsenal designed to combat a multitude of threats, including those arising from phishing attacks. Intercept X employs proactive measures to neutralise threats before they can cause harm.

Key Features of Sophos Intercept X:

  • Exploit Prevention: Intercept X prevents the exploitation of vulnerabilities often targeted in phishing attacks, thereby thwarting the initial stages of compromise.
  • CryptoGuard Technology: Specifically designed to detect and prevent ransomware encryption, CryptoGuard adds an additional layer of defence against threats that may be introduced through phishing.

4. User Education and Awareness: A Collaborative Defence

Overview:

Sophos recognises the importance of user education and awareness in the fight against phishing attacks. While technological measures play a crucial role, Sophos encourages users to be vigilant and discerning in their online interactions.

Key Strategies for User Education:

  • Training Resources: Sophos provides educational resources and training materials to help users recognise phishing attempts and adopt best practices for online security.
  • Simulated Phishing Exercises: Sophos offers simulated phishing exercises to organisations, allowing them to assess and enhance their employees’ ability to identify and avoid phishing threats.
